An important note: busy times vs hold times vs best time to call
When we refer to busy or less busy times, we are talking about the volume of calls. The busiest times are when the most people are calling this eBay phone number (least busy times have fewer people calling). This high call volume does not necessarily mean that you will have a long hold time when you call. Companies like eBay staff their call centers differently based on the time of day and day of the week, so you may experience a shorter wait on hold at the busiest of times. When we refer to the best time to call, we are referring to the optimal combination of lower call volume and shorter wait times.

Best Practices for Calling eBay Customer Service

If you are calling eBay regarding a transaction between yourself and a buyer or seller, keep in mind that eBay expects buyers and sellers to try and work out their issues independently.

However, if a good-faith attempt at resolving the issue with your buyer or seller isn't working, a call to eBay customer service may be in order. Before calling, make sure that eBay customer service is open. eBay provides phone-based customer support from 5 AM to 10 PM Pacific time every day of the week.

eBay asks that you use its website when calling so that it can appropriately direct your call. Visit the contact page on eBay and click on the "Call Us" link. From there, you'll be taken to a series of menus that list common reasons for calling eBay.

Eventually, you'll be prompted to click on your reason for contacting eBay. From there, you'll be provided with a number to call and an identification code that you should enter into the eBay phone system for a fast response.

This page will also provide you with an estimated wait time to speak to a live person. If you don't want to wait, you can go back to eBay's main contact page and request a callback at a time that is convenient for you.

It is important to have all relevant documentation in front of you when contacting eBay by phone. This includes correspondence between yourself and the other party, screenshots of the product and its description, tracking numbers and proof of payment.

What Kind of Issues can eBay Customer Support Resolve?

eBay customer support can resolve a range of issues, including identifying and researching credit card or payment method transactions, technical support issues and providing answers to questions about how the eBay platform works. A call to eBay customer support can also help sellers get listing fees refunded in the case of a transaction gone awry.

In addition, eBay customer service can provide mediation between buyers and sellers who are in conflict. Buyers who did not receive an ordered item may be able to file a claim under eBay's money-back guarantee.

What Can't Be Resolved by Phone With eBay?

Because eBay is a merchant platform, rather than a direct seller of products, there can be some challenges in resolving disputes between its customers. eBay cannot, for example, reship an item that was lost in the mail or directly provide additional compensation to a buyer who received a product or had a poor experience.

What can I do if I am Unhappy With my call to eBay?

If you have had a bad experience with eBay phone based customer service, don't lose heart. You may still have options. First, You didn't take notes during your conversation with eBay, write down or type out what happened during your call. This information can be useful when getting back in touch with eBay.

Secondly, call eBay back. The next representative you speak to maybe in a better position to address your concerns.

If your second call doesn't go well, try a different method of getting in touch. You can use eBay's online contact form to submit your issue in writing. You can also connect with other users on eBay's community forums to get advice on dealing with your concern.
